Guide-Price: ?450,000 - ?475,000
Located just moments away from the Woodmansterne Railway Station, this three/ four-bedroom semi-detached property comes to the market chain-free with a south-east-facing rear garden and perfect for anyone looking to put their own stamp on it.

The interior is in need of modernisation and comprises of multiple reception rooms, kitchen, bathroom and fourth bedroom/additional reception room on the ground floor. The first floor consists of three further bedrooms.

Externally the property benefits from a mostly-level, south-east facing rear garden, garage, off-street parking for multiple cars and potential to extend subject to planning permission.

Woodmansterne, Coulsdon South and Coulsdon Town Railway Stations offer swift and easy access to a variety of destinations including London Victoria, London Bridge, Kings Cross, St. Pancras International, Gatwick Airport and Brighton, while the M23/M25 interchange at Hooley provides easy access to the South Coast, Gatwick Airport and the national motorway network. In addition the surrounding area is well-served by a variety of bus routes.

Local shops include Waitrose and additional supermarkets along with further shopping opportunities and gyms across Croydon, while Coulsdon High Street has a number of popular restaurants. Local green spaces include the stunning Farthing Downs and Coulsdon Memorial Park in addition to beautiful Surrey Countryside.

There are also a number of golf courses in the local vicinity including Coulsdon Court, Woodcote Park, Chipstead, Surrey Downs, and Kingswood while there are also a number of local sports clubs and leisure facilities. Coulsdon also includes a range of highly-rated schools including Chipstead Valley Primary School, Smitham, Oasis Academy, Woodcote Primary School, Woodcote High School and Coulsdon Sixth Form College.
